Are you sure you are entering the X Y and Z coordinates in the right place and in the right direction? Especially the z coordinate?
I just ran the game and refreshed my memory with the grid. If I knew which planets coordinates you were trying I could give you exact instructions but I will try with these generic instructions...
Take your X-Y-Z coordinates, set your Z coordinate on the under side of the grid first. The key here is to start from the top and count down.
Once you have that Z coordinate set correctly go back up to the grid. Starting in the lower left corner, count to the right and set the small round button exactly on your X coordinate. Once you have the X coordinate set correctly and from that point count up the grid the number for your Y coordinate and place the round marker exactly there. Now you have all the coordinates set correctly. X - Y on the Grid and the Z underneath.
Now press the rectangular button in the upper right hand corner of the grid and your ship should be on its way
